资源简介:
本数据集依托国家重点研发计划项目“晶圆级芯片系统级开发环境设计与验证研究”,课题三“晶圆级芯片模型抽象与构建技术”,记录了晶圆级芯片算核库研发过程中的完整数据,涵盖算核仿真规模、计算算核、存储算核、网络算核的测试样例、运行脚本及仿真过程记录文件。数据集严格依据国家或行业标准,通过多次会议讨论和专家评审,完成了项目核心指标的功能性与兼容性验证:支持不少于100个算核、兼容 X86/GPU/ 类 SW64 等 3 种以上指令集、支持共享式 / 消息传递式 2 种以上存储访问方式、兼容 Mesh / 环型 / 树型 / 非标准 4 种以上网络拓扑结构。数据采集采用标准化操作规程,保留了原始运行数据、统计指标及日志文件,通过 Linux 系统工具解析与可视化处理确保数据可追溯性与可读性。本数据集为晶圆级芯片算核库的性能优化、算法验证及硬件兼容性测试提供了标准化、可复现的数据支撑,推动新一代集成电路芯片的研发与应用。
This dataset is developed based on the National Key R&D Program of China project "Design and Verification Research on Wafer-level Chip System-level Development Environment" and Task 3 "Wafer-level Chip Model Abstraction and Construction Technology". It records complete data generated during the R&D process of the wafer-level chip computing core library, covering test cases, running scripts, and simulation process record files for computing core simulation scale, computing cores, memory cores, and network cores. The dataset strictly complies with national and industry standards, and has completed the functional and compatibility verification of the project's core indicators through multiple discussions and expert reviews: it supports no fewer than 100 computing cores, is compatible with at least three instruction sets including X86, GPU, and SW64-like, supports at least two memory access modes including shared and message-passing, and is compatible with at least four network topologies including Mesh, ring, tree, and non-standard ones. Data collection follows standardized operating procedures, retains original operating data, statistical indicators and log files, and ensures data traceability and readability through Linux system tools for parsing and visualization processing. This dataset provides standardized and reproducible data support for performance optimization, algorithm verification and hardware compatibility testing of the wafer-level chip computing core library, and promotes the R&D and application of a new generation of integrated circuit chips.
